| 0:16.0 | Planet Plant. |
| 0:18.6 | Far away on a distant arm of the Milky Way galaxy, there is a pale blue planet orbiting |
| 0:24.8 | its own sun. The planet was once a lush green place, crowded with towering trees, fields of |
| 0:32.4 | flowers and sprawling plants. But, unlike our own Earth, this planet had no animals, birds, or even insects. |
| 0:42.5 | The creatures of this planet were different, for they too were plants. There were two intelligent |
| 0:49.2 | plant species that lived on this world. The ice plants looked something like a cross between a flower and a gorilla. |
| 0:57.3 | They were bulky blooms with thick root-like arms and faces surrounded by petals. |
| 1:03.7 | They were extremely clever, finding ways to adapt and change plants to suit their needs. |
| 1:10.7 | They were happy just as long as they didn't |
| 1:13.2 | run into a chickpea. The chickpeas were the other main species. Unlike the ice plants, |
| 1:20.1 | they didn't have broad bodies, but tiny golden yellow ones that included a single eye and a large |
| 1:27.2 | mouth. Although their bodies were small, |
| 1:30.3 | their arms and legs were very, very long, made up of twisting, knotted creepers. They spent their |
| 1:38.6 | time studying the smaller plant-like creatures of the planet, domesticating some to live alongside them. |
| 1:45.9 | It was a good life, unless, of course, they bumped into an ice plant. |
| 1:51.4 | As more and more ice plants came into the world, they grew bigger and more complicated places |
| 1:58.0 | to live, creating vast cities made from modified plants. |
| 2:03.4 | In time, the natural forests and meadows began to vanish as the ice plants spread. |
| 2:10.0 | Meanwhile, the chickpeas became farmers, breeding their chosen species of plant creatures. |
| 2:16.5 | And the more chickpeas there were, the more space they needed for |
